Output 7cc62ceb3e330ddfbaec8b42afa8124e27c686604cefce6beb08005afd38b4e6:1

value
76420424
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1566752ea3678a4b32a3b54c74d918362b6ca32d OP_EQUALVERIFY OP_CHECKSIG
address
12x9vvCXAAxzhy1C2bSKBcV9S4QhZQ35Cu
transaction
7cc62ceb3e330ddfbaec8b42afa8124e27c686604cefce6beb08005afd38b4e6
spent
true